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ations

  • Range and placement: If you need data from many rooms or outdoor areas, prioritize models with 330–500 ft remote range and robust signal transmission.
  • Display features: Decide between simple numeric displays and full weather stations with clock, forecast, heat index, and dew point indicators.
  • Sensor accuracy: Look for sensors with sub-degree temperature accuracy and humidity within a few percent for reliable indoor/outdoor readings.
  • Power and hub needs: Some units are battery-powered and wire-free; others may require a hub or manual syncing. Consider your setup preferences.
  • Weather resistance: Outdoor sensors should withstand humidity and temperature extremes. IP ratings and enclosure design matter for longevity.
  • Alerts and trends: If monitoring for mold risk or climate-sensitive activities, choose models with trend arrows and alert features for thresholds.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• What is a digital outdoor temperature gauge? – It is a device that measures indoor and outdoor temperatures, often with humidity readings, transmitted to a display or app for easy monitoring.
  • Do these devices require Wi-Fi? – Some do, but many work via radio frequency transmission between the sensor and the display without Wi-Fi.
  • What range should I expect for accurate readings? – Most reliable units provide 165–500 feet of remote range, depending on obstacles and line-of-sight.
  • Can environmental conditions affect accuracy? – Yes, direct sun, heat sources, and damp environments can influence readings; choose properly shielded sensors for best accuracy.
  • Is backlighting important? – Backlit displays improve readability in low light, which is helpful for bedrooms or garages.
  • Which model is best for a greenhouse? – A unit with a long remote range, stable transmission, and humidity readings is ideal; consider models designed for continuous climate monitoring.
